Resources

Copline 800.267.5463

Law Enforcement Crisis Line answered by retired law enforcement officers.

WWW.copline.org


First Responder Therapists

Click HERE to view a list of culturally competent therapist by region. You are responsible for interviewing these therapists for insurance coverage, personal fit, philosophy, methodologies, and availability, etc. Use the therapists on this list at your own discretion. 

National Suicide Prevention Lifeline: 988

The Lifeline provides 24/7 free and confidential support for people in distress, prevention and crisis resources for you or you loved ones.

NICISM 800.225.2473

NICISM is made up of trained volunteers from the mental health and emergency service professions. NICISM comes to you for Defusing, Debriefing and Demobilization, On-scene support, referrals, and educational services.   

The 100 Club of Illinois www.100clubil.org

Providing resources, financial support, access to training, and moral support to both the families of 1st responders killed in the line of duty & active duty 1st responders throughout the state of IL. 

First HELP (Blue HELP/Red HELP)

First HELP (Blue HELP/Red HELP)

 Reducing mental health stigma through education, advocating for benefits for those suffering from post-traumatic stress, acknowledging the service and sacrifice of first responders we lost to suicide, support families after a suicide.

Safe Call Now www.safecallnowusa.org

First HELP (Blue HELP/Red HELP)

  Safe Call Now is a CONFIDENTIAL, comprehensive, 24-hour crisis referral service for all public safety employees, all emergency services personnel and their family members nationwide. 

We Never Walk Alone www.WeNeverWalkAlone.org

Serves as a resource for LEO MEMBERS to obtain varied treatment options, educational material, external sources, real time interaction with advisors and peers, share survival stories, access lifestyle information, retreat information and much more. See also We Never Fight Alone: www.WeNeverFightAlone.org for MEMBER Firefighter Support. 

NAMI: Frontline Professionals www.NAMI.org

NAMI Frontline Wellness offers resources and tools developed specifically for public safety and health care professionals, and their family members. 

Share the Load www.nvfc.org/helpline

Share the Load www.nvfc.org/helpline

 Provides access to critical resources and information to help first responders and their families manage and overcome personal and work-related problems.  Free 24-hour assistance for MEMBERS with issues such as stress, depression, addiction, PTSD, and more.
